Wolves to learn 2025/26 fixtures

The 2025/26 ball begins to roll for the Premier League this week with the revealing of a brand new set of fixtures.

At 9am on Wednesday 18th June Wolves and the other 19 top flight clubs will learn their full schedule for the new Premier League campaign, which begins in two months’ time.

All 380 matches will be confirmed, with the first taking place the weekend of Saturday 16th August and the last on Sunday 24th May – 18 days before the 2026 World Cup begins.

The schedule will consist of 33 weekend matches and five midweek rounds, while no club will play twice within 60 hours during the traditionally busy Christmas period.

Unlike in 2023, when Wolves hosted Chelsea at Molineux, there will be no Christmas Eve fixture.

Clubs cannot begin and end the season with two home or two away fixtures, while no club can play at home on both the fixture closest to Boxing Day and New Year’s Day.

The Old Gold will have games with Leeds United, Burnley and Sunderland this season, following their promotion from the Championship, with relegated Leicester City, Ipswich Town and Southampton now off the schedule.

The summer transfer window is now back open and will run until Monday 1st September.
